Instant Pot Chicken and wild rice soup


This is Danica’s soup recipe adapted for the instant pot! 

1/2 cup chopped onion
1 cup chopped Celery 
1 cup chopped/shredded carrots
6 cups chicken broth
1 - 1 1/2 Pounds frozen or raw chicken breasts/tenderloins
2 Boxes Rice A Rone Wild Rice with seasonings 
2 bay leaves 
1/2 tsp salt and pepper 

Sauté the veggies in some oil for a few minutes. Add the remaining ingredients, stirring before adding the chicken.
Cook on manual pressure for 14 minutes. Allow slow release for a few minutes before releasing the rest of the way. 
Remove chicken and shred or dice. Add back to soup. 

In a small saucepan on the stove, make a roux with the below ingredients

1/3 cup flour
5 Tbsp butter 
1 14oz can Evaporated Milk plus more milk to equal 2 cups total (Could use milk or cream or whatever but the evaporated milk is what makes this soup phenomenal.)

Melt the butter, add the flour then slowly add milk. Stir on medium heat until thickened. About 2-3 minutes. 

Add the roux to the soup. Stir and serve!
